Farmers all across india 🇮🇳 are the least earning and most distressed 😟 class while they are the ones who provide the most basic need for humanity to survive i.e. FOOD 🥘.

All through recent years they were convinced by successive governments to produce more and more by using toxic chemicals used in fertiliser and insecticide.

All these practices have resulted in reduced return to farmers and toxic farm produce leading to health issues to consumers.
